ROLE REQUIREMENTS

As a Production Coordinator, you report to a Senior Producer, and will:

  • Support pre-production phase:
    • By fleshing out a project’s planning to monitor deadlines
    • Build briefing document and participate in briefing the different partners
    • Booking and coordinating internal resources
    • Organizing key meetings and tracking key milestones
    • Taking care of the administrative workflow (contracts, estimates, SOW, PO, etc.)
  • Support production phase 
    • Assist with travel coordination and logistics for shoots
    • Contribute to the preparation and organization of shooting documents
    • Support the development of CGI assets, both in-house and in collaboration with external studios
    • Keep follow-up tools up to date to monitor the financial tracking of a project
    • Provide general production support across various tasks as needed
  • Support post-production phase: 
    • Organizing key meetings and keeping notes of the topics
    • Keep clear filing of documents & track project history in share folders
    • Monitoring creative reviews with creative teams and partners
    • Ensure that what’s being delivered meets the initial brief and the quality standard of AKQA
  • Use AKQA Project Management Tools to effectively initiate a project in the system, track and monitor a project’s financial status
  • Escalate status and potential issues of the projects to your manager
  • Archive the final deliverables following the AKQA process, closing the projects
  • Oversee the regulation and follow-up of the buyouts
  • Start to develop knowledge of various talents and production companies on the market
